Tonopah, Arizona is a small town located approximately 50 miles west of Phoenix. It has a population of around 4,000 people and is known for its wide-open spaces and desert landscape. The town has a low cost of living and is popular among retirees and those looking for a quiet, rural lifestyle.
In general, users on BestPlaces.net have mixed reviews about living in Tonopah, Arizona. Some appreciate the peacefulness and affordability of the town, while others find it too isolated and lacking in amenities.
